What is Forex Trading?
Forex trading, or FX trading, involves the exchange of one currency for another with the goal of making a profit. The exchange rates between currencies are influenced by economic factors, geopolitical events, and market sentiment, making Forex a highly dynamic market.
Key Concepts and Terminology for Success Strategies For Forex Trading
Currency Pairs: In forex, currencies are always traded in pairs. For example, the EUR/USD pair represents the euro and the US dollar.
Pip: A pip is the smallest price movement in a currency pair, used to measure gains or losses.
Leverage: Leverage allows traders to control a larger position than their actual capital, amplifying both potential profits and losses.
Spread: The difference between the buy and sell price of a currency pair, often seen as the broker’s fee.
Top Success Strategies For Forex Trading
Choosing the right strategy is crucial to succeeding in Forex. Below are some of the most popular trading strategies used by successful Forex traders:
Success Forex Trading Strategies 1: Scalping
Scalping is a short-term strategy that involves making quick trades to profit from small price movements. Traders typically open and close positions within minutes, capitalizing on minor fluctuations in currency prices.
Pros:
- Quick profit potential
- Low exposure to market risk
Cons:
- Requires high focus and discipline
- Transaction costs can add up
Success Forex Trading Strategies 2: Swing Trading
Swing trading is a medium-term strategy where traders aim to capture price “swings” or trends over several days or weeks. This strategy requires patience and the ability to identify key support and resistance levels in the market.
Pros:
- Easier to manage than scalping
- Can be used with a variety of technical analysis tools
Cons:
- Requires more time to monitor than longer-term strategies
- Risk of market reversal
Success Strategies For Forex Trading 3: Day Trading
Day trading involves entering and exiting positions within the same trading day. The goal is to profit from short-term price movements without holding positions overnight, which helps avoid overnight risks.
Pros:
- Avoids overnight market risk
- Suitable for traders who prefer high activity
Cons:
- Requires constant monitoring of the market
- High transaction costs
Success Strategies For Forex Trading 4: Trend Following
Trend following is based on the idea that markets move in trends, and by identifying and trading in the direction of the trend, traders can capture significant moves. Trend traders often use moving averages and other technical indicators to confirm the market’s direction.
Pros:
- Can yield significant returns if trends are sustained
- Can be applied to various timeframes
Cons:
- Risk of entering too late or exiting too early
- False signals can lead to losses
Risk Management: Protecting Your Capital

Effective risk management is the key to long-term success in Forex trading. While trading offers opportunities for profit, it also carries the risk of significant loss. Here are some essential risk management techniques:
Importance of Managing Risk in Forex
Capital Preservation: Never risk more than a small percentage of your trading capital on a single trade. Many experts recommend risking no more than 1-2% of your account on each trade.
Use of Stop-Loss Orders: A stop-loss order automatically closes a position at a predetermined price to limit potential losses.
Position Sizing: Adjust the size of your trades according to the level of risk you are willing to take. Larger positions mean larger potential profits, but they also increase risk.
Tools and Techniques for Risk Management
Risk-to-Reward Ratio: This ratio helps traders assess the potential return relative to the amount of risk. A common strategy is aiming for a risk-to-reward ratio of at least 1:3.
Diversification: Avoid concentrating all your funds in one currency pair. Spread your risk by trading multiple pairs that are not highly correlated.
Tips for Success in Forex Trading
While having a solid strategy is crucial, there are other factors that can contribute to your success as a forex trader:
Staying Disciplined
The most successful traders are those who stick to their plan and remain disciplined, even when the market is volatile. Avoid emotional trading, as decisions driven by fear or greed often lead to poor outcomes.
Analyzing the Market
In addition to using trading strategies, always conduct thorough market analysis. There are two primary types of analysis:
Technical Analysis: Involves studying price charts and using indicators to predict future market movements.
Fundamental Analysis: Focuses on economic indicators, news, and events that influence currency prices.
